
Where should a golf carry bag sit?
How to carry your carry bagAdjust the straps on the bag so you feel that "the weight is evenly distributed on each shoulder."The bag should be leaning at a 20-to-25-degree angle across your back.Feel the bag resting against the small of your back—no higher or lower.Always walk tall.More items...•

How do you carry a golf cart bag with one strap?
To carry a golf bag with one strap, you should use your dominant shoulder because it will most likely have much more stamina. When you start to feel tired on one side, then you could switch shoulders to give your main side a break. Another tip is to go ahead and try to adjust your strap for the best results.

How do I keep my golf bag from falling down?
Store-bought solutions: Anti-twist sleeves: The cart strap is threaded through the bag's anti-twist sleeve. Anti-twist strap: A strap on the bag fastens to the cart frame. Non-slip materials applied to the bag bottom. The shape of the bag's bottom.

Is it a good exercise to carry a golf bag?
His findings indicate that physical benefits of carrying your bag are minimal. Golfers in his study who carried their clubs burned an average of 721 calories over 9 holes compared to 718 calories burned by golfers who used a push cart.

What is a double strap golf bag?
A double strap golf bag features two straps that are worn over each shoulder like a backpack, which helps distribute the weight of the clubs more evenly.

Pay Attention to the Quality and Type of Strap
Golf bag straps can be made from nylon or leather, often with reinforced pads or rubber grips. Most golf bags have a handle on the side, so you can pick the bag up and move it in addition to the shoulder strap.

Ditch any Excess Weight
Try and avoid the mentality of ‘just in case’ club packing. Pack only the clubs you will really use and leave the rest behind. This will significantly lighten the load.

How to hold a golf ball off the ground?
Put some golf tees in your bag. Golf tees are the short pegs you use to hold your golf ball off the ground before hitting it with one of your woods at the beginning of each hole. It is common to go through several tees during a golf game, so pack extra tees in a side pocket of your golf bag.
